Thirty terrific physics projects from everyone’ s favorite science teacher This invaluable guide to physics projects, written for middle and high school students, details how to put together projects that showcase key physics concepts. In this latest volume in her successful series of science fair project books, Janice VanCleave provides thirty comprehensive projects– on measurement, force and motion, states of matter, energy, and electricity– that come complete with illustrations, charts, diagrams, and suggestions for original projects on related topics. Whether students want to work with pendulums, lenses, or parallel circuits, this book provides the inspiration and hands-on help they need to assure science fair success. Janice VanCleave (Riesel, TX) is a former elementary and high school science teacher who now spends her time writing and giving science workshops. She is the author of more than forty children’ s science books, with sales totaling more than 2 million copies.

This new series uses everyday objects--kitchen utensils, doorbells--familiar critters--ants!--and readily available substances--air and water--to create winning science fair projects for upper elementary and middle-school kids. Each title includes step-by-step instructions which enable kids to create their own independent science fair projects, as well as the underlying scientific concept learned during the experiment. This series meets national science education standards.



National Middle School Science Bowl - Science Bowl is a middle school academic competition, similar to Quiz Bowl, held in the United States. Two teams of four students each compete to answer various science-related questions.

Science fair - A science fair is generally a competition where contestants create a project related to science or some scientific phenomenon.
